Maintenance Workers, Machinery Salary in South Carolina
SOC 49-9043 · South Carolina · BLS OEWS May 2024
The median salary for Maintenance Workers, Machinery in South Carolina is $62,608 per year ($30.10/hr). This is 3.5% higher than the national median of $60,507. The middle 50% earn between $51,646 and $75,629 annually. Top earners at the 90th percentile reach $79,685.
Wage Percentiles: South Carolina
| Percentile | Hourly Rate | Annual Salary | vs National |
|---|---|---|---|
| P10 | $21.38 | $44,470 | +10.9% |
| P25 | $24.83 | $51,646 | +6.3% |
| P50MEDIAN | $30.10 | $62,608 | +3.5% |
| P75 | $36.36 | $75,629 | +4.7% |
| P90 | $38.31 | $79,685 | -4.6% |
